1. Real-Time PMS Sync: No More Outdated Calendars

Guests will not tolerate friction—especially around availability. A booking engine that syncs in real-time with your Property Management System (PMS) ensures instant updates for rates and calendars. This eliminates embarrassing double bookings, builds trust, and removes hesitation in the booking funnel.

  • Makes your calendar always accurate, reducing customer service headaches.
  • Less risk of negative reviews due to overbooking or pricing errors.

2. Frictionless Professional Checkout (Built for Conversion)

Any delay or confusion in your checkout flow increases abandonment. A well-designed, step-by-step booking form with clear progress indicators keeps guests moving forward. We find a checkout process integrated seamlessly with the PMS’s payment gateway (or modern alternatives like Stripe and PayPal) removes anxiety and gets more completed reservations.

  • Guests complete bookings without popups, redirects, or laggy performance.
  • Modern guest expectations are set by e-commerce—your flow should match that standard.

3. Advanced Multi-Property Search & Filtering

With modern booking engines, you can provide guests the ability to search by more than just dates and destination. Filter by bedrooms, amenities, neighborhood, price range, and custom attributes. This isn’t just about aesthetics: guiding guests to their perfect property faster improves user satisfaction and booking conversion rates.

  • Reduce overwhelm by helping guests quickly zero in on options that fit their needs.
  • Customizable filters fit unique inventory (luxury only, pet-friendly, pools, etc).

4. Mobile-First Design: Don’t Lose Smartphone Bookers

More than half of direct booking sessions now start on mobile. Your booking experience should be obsessively designed so every filter, property display, and checkout field is touch-friendly and visually clear at any screen size. Test the whole flow on both iOS and Android devices regularly.

  • Responsive layouts and touch-optimized buttons are not optional—they are required by guests.

5. Indexable Property Pages (SEO-Friendly Booking)

Each property should have its own SEO-optimized page, fully hosted on your domain. That way, Google can index your inventory and send you free organic leads. Unified design and flexible content blocks allow you to tell a compelling story for each listing—something the major platforms cannot do for you.

  • Let guests discover you directly from search, not just from listing sites.
  • Property details, local insights, reviews, and unique selling points all build trust here.

6. Custom Property Collections and Grouping

Trend-driven travelers love curated experiences. With custom property collections, you can instantly create “Pet-Friendly Escapes,” “Luxury Lakeviews,” or “Family Getaways”—all with unique branding, content, and filters. This flexible organization can often be set up in minutes with the right engine, unlocking targeted campaigns and seasonality packages without messy code.

  • Give guests visual clarity and inspiration for group trips, corporate stays, or themed holidays.
  • Data-backed collections can address demand spikes or new market segments.

7. Automated Discount Codes and Dynamic Pricing Display

Without interrupting your workflow, the ability to push discounts or dynamic pricing—driven from your PMS or a dedicated engine—nudges fence-sitters to book direct. Modern engines can display strikethrough pricing, flash deals, or seasonal rates tailored to guest search patterns.

  • Last-minute and shoulder season discounts can be shown only when relevant.
  • Discount codes layered into checkout drive urgency and reward repeat guests.

8. Add-Ons & Upsells in the Booking Flow

Increase revenue per stay by offering add-ons like early check-in, pet fees, groceries, or local experiences directly in the booking engine. PMS-integrated upsells keep everything tracked in one place and delight guests, who often want to personalize their trip—but hate searching later for “extras” or calling your team.

  • Streamlines operations because all bookings and add-ons appear in your master dashboard.
  • Grows average booking value with zero extra staff effort.

9. Flexible Payment Gateway Options

If you’ve ever lost a booking due to limited payment options, you know how crucial this is. Modern booking engines work with your PMS to support multiple gateways, including Stripe, PayPal, Authorize.net, Square, and dozens of regional or alternative methods. This broad support means guests can pay in the way that suits them, anywhere in the world.

  • Reduces abandonment by supporting preferred or local payment options.
  • Simplifies accounting and refunds because everything is synced with the PMS.

10. Real-Time Analytics & Conversion Insights

Guessing what’s working is a path to wasted ad spend. An analytics-rich booking engine provides real-time data on traffic, guest search patterns, drop-off points, and conversion rates. This allows you to optimize offers, layouts, and content—sometimes in days rather than months.

  • See which property collections get the most interest (and turn views into stays).
  • AI-powered recommendations and conversion heatmaps can highlight hidden opportunities to improve.

11. Customizable Price and Fee Presentation

We’ve seen firsthand how transparent, customizable fee breakdowns cut guest friction. A booking engine that lets you surface rates, discounts, taxes, cleaning fees, and add-ons clearly (and in local currency) removes surprises. It’s a small detail that builds trust and reduces pre-arrival angst.

  • Showcase your fair pricing policy—no hidden fees or gotchas on the final booking step.
  • Customize display to align with brand tone or property type as needed.
